Output 3374636faad731d2b7ebfa94deacba023d730ee7f154c3d9c088d178e484dc6e:3

value
455043
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d80e450941fb621320bbab0d26abc9034678aaf8acdf7e5ffd3574a65dd5ed14
address
tb1pmq8y2z2pld3pxg9m4vxjd27fqdr832hc4n0huhlax462vhw4a52qg3c8y7
transaction
3374636faad731d2b7ebfa94deacba023d730ee7f154c3d9c088d178e484dc6e
confirmations
70460
spent
true